Summary: | dev-lua/toluapp-1.0.93 : NameError: name Options is not defined: |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Toralf Förster <toralf> |
Component: | Current packages | Assignee: | Rafael Martins (RETIRED) <rafaelmartins> |
Status: | RESOLVED FIXED | ||
Severity: | normal | CC: | bjh-gentoobt, thomas |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Attachments: |
emerge-info.txt
dev-lua:toluapp-1.0.93:20190306-221353.log emerge-history.txt environment etc.portage.tbz2 temp.tbz2 |
Created attachment 568098 [details]
emerge-info.txt
Created attachment 568100 [details]
dev-lua:toluapp-1.0.93:20190306-221353.log
Created attachment 568102 [details]
emerge-history.txt
Created attachment 568104 [details]
environment
Created attachment 568106 [details]
etc.portage.tbz2
Created attachment 568108 [details]
temp.tbz2
*** Bug 676188 has been marked as a duplicate of this bug. *** The build works if you use scons < 3.0.0, i.e.: --- toluapp-1.0.93.ebuild 2019-03-26 23:28:10.581302524 +0100 +++ toluapp-1.0.93-r1.ebuild 2019-03-26 21:05:17.069776752 +0100 @@ -18,7 +18,7 @@ RDEPEND=">=dev-lang/lua-5.1.1[deprecated]" DEPEND="${RDEPEND} - dev-util/scons" + <dev-util/scons-3.0.0" S=${WORKDIR}/${MY_P} The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=ef56c689570380dc0808b4c7e21195b759b10155 commit ef56c689570380dc0808b4c7e21195b759b10155 Author: David Seifert <soap@gentoo.org> AuthorDate: 2019-05-15 09:28:38 +0000 Commit: David Seifert <soap@gentoo.org> CommitDate: 2019-05-15 09:28:38 +0000 dev-lua/toluapp: Use CMake for building Closes: https://bugs.gentoo.org/399201 Closes: https://bugs.gentoo.org/590944 Closes: https://bugs.gentoo.org/648656 Closes: https://bugs.gentoo.org/679706 Package-Manager: Portage-2.3.66, Repoman-2.3.12 Signed-off-by: David Seifert <soap@gentoo.org> dev-lua/toluapp/Manifest | 1 + .../toluapp-1.0.93_p20190513-fix-multilib.patch | 37 ++ .../files/toluapp-1.0.93_p20190513-lua5.3.patch | 534 +++++++++++++++++++++ dev-lua/toluapp/toluapp-1.0.93_p20190513.ebuild | 29 ++ 4 files changed, 601 insertions(+) |
>>> Compiling source in /var/tmp/portage/dev-lua/toluapp-1.0.93/work/tolua++-1.0.93 ... scons: Reading SConscript files ... NameError: name 'Options' is not defined: File "/var/tmp/portage/dev-lua/toluapp-1.0.93/work/tolua++-1.0.93/SConstruct", line 19: opts = Options(["config_"+options_file+".py", "custom.py", "custom_"+options_file+".py"], ARGUMENTS) * ERROR: dev-lua/toluapp-1.0.93::gentoo failed (compile phase): ------------------------------------------------------------------- This is an unstable amd64 chroot image at a tinderbox (==build bot) name: 17.1-desktop-plasma_libressl_20190302-221911 ------------------------------------------------------------------- gcc-config -l: [1] x86_64-pc-linux-gnu-8.3.0 * Available Python interpreters, in order of preference: [1] python3.7 [2] python3.6 [3] python2.7 (fallback) [4] jython2.7 (fallback) Available Ruby profiles: [1] ruby24 (with Rubygems) * [2] ruby25 (with Rubygems) [3] ruby26 (with Rubygems) Available Rust versions: [1] rust-1.32.0 * java-config: The following VMs are available for generation-2: *) IcedTea JDK 3.10.0 [icedtea-bin-8] Available Java Virtual Machines: [1] icedtea-bin-8 system-vm emerge -qpvO dev-lua/toluapp [ebuild N ] dev-lua/toluapp-1.0.93